Skip to content

Provide guidance on upgrading from adyen-java-api-library v4.1.0 to v40.0.0 for Checkout API v71 #1576

@usmanarogundade

Description

@usmanarogundade

Feature summary

This issue requests official upgrade guidance and documentation for migrating from adyen-java-api-library v4.1.0 to v40.0.0 to support Checkout API v71.

Problem statement

Hi team,

We’re working with a merchant who is currently using adyen-java-api-library v4.1.0 with Checkout API v69 and is looking to upgrade to Checkout API v71.

They’re evaluating the latest library version v40.0.0, but given the large version gap, they would like some guidance on:

Key breaking or structural changes between v4.1.0 and v40.0.0

Any recommended migration path or tools to identify differences (e.g., generated models, renamed classes, removed endpoints)

Known backward-incompatibility considerations or best practices when upgrading to v40.0.0 in order to support Checkout API v71

From the Checkout perspective, we plan to reference the API Diff Tool for v69 → v71, but additional insights or documentation on the Java library side would be very helpful.

Thanks in advance for any resources, notes, or upgrade guidelines you can share!

Proposed solution

Context:

Current library: v4.1.0

Target library: v40.0.0

Current Checkout API: v69

Target Checkout API: v71

Alternatives considered

No response

Additional context

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    QuestionIndicates issue only requires an answer to a question

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ions